I've got a dozen in my kitchen right now. I try and wait until the day after Easter, and hit the candy closeout sales after the stores close. I usually can buy up enough to last me through mid-July. Creme Eggs are the way to go... I don't really care for the chocolate or caramel at all. The creme is just so perfect, and the chocolate is high quality.

As far as hot deals go, try to buy the eggs in "flats". They sell them in sets of 18. I haven't found a set of 18 creme eggs yet this year. Instead they are packing 12 creme eggs w/ 3 caramel and 3 chocolate. I put my eggs in the freezer for storage for fear of them going bad for any reason.

I will say that the Cadburry mini-eggs aren't bad at all. The ratio of chocolate to creme is off, but the creme and chocolate are still excellent.
